A few years ago, our national pres, Sarah Coons Lindsay wrote an article about it for President's Message in the Trident. She said that the official stand on it is that it's "Tri Delta." This was probably 2004 or 2005.

Tri Delt is considered slang in my chapter we also dont use the word Delt because that is the Delta Tau Delta nickname. Tri Delta is the correct nickname and yes there is no "-" also we may use Deltas but only in our house because we dont want to offend the wonderful ladies of Delta Sigma Theta who are nationally known as Deltas.
